2017-01-05 55 views
1

我想將我的jupyter筆記本轉換爲使用nbconvert的演示文稿。是否可以將matplotlib圖放置在幻燈片的中心?如何在nbconvert後將matplotlib圖的位置居中?

在jupyter中,我阻止顯示我的代碼,然後繪製一張圖。

(RawNBConvert)

<style type="text/css"> 
.input_prompt, .input_area, .output_prompt { 
    display:none !important; 
} 
</style> 

(蟒)

%matplotlib inline 
import matplotlib.pyplot as plt 

plt.plot([1,2,3]); 

然後,該筆記本使用下面的命令轉換成HTML:

jupyter nbconvert mynote.ipynb --to slides 

結果HTML呈現像這個。 enter image description here

我一直在試圖將這個情節集中在我的幻燈片中。我看着我的reveal.css文件,但無法弄清楚哪一部分要改變。有誰知道我該如何解決這個問題?

我使用jupyter 1.0.0和nbconvert 4.2.0。

回答

0

可能有更好的解決方案,但在RawNBConvert單元中添加幾行解決了這個問題。我希望這不會導致副作用。

<style type="text/css"> 
.input_prompt, .input_area, .output_prompt { 
    display:none !important; 
} 

div.output_png { 
    display: flex; 
    justify-content: center; 
} 

</style> 

enter image description here

相關問題